I remeber watching a Japanese game show about sharpening, it was a hand craft vs machine craft kinda thing. To get to the point the machine people would use a sacrificial mag block to support the edge in order to eliminate burrs on the edge

This video by Adam the machinist goes over a cheap way to make mag blocks:
